Transaction 44db2ea3f8b779652a433918709d000ec163ff15f3620d21db80c7ee7d1952e8
1 Input
1 Output
-
44db2ea3f8b779652a433918709d000ec163ff15f3620d21db80c7ee7d1952e8:0
- value
- 43367884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9c5855be11c05aeae980dc026146a3c29a47f89 OP_EQUAL
- address
- 3MYVBAaeonMUthh92FFbFwHFf3mgpqUNDZ